Hello. Do the red dots on the global fire map indicate areas with active fires, or do they mean something else? According to this map, does it mean that almost everywhere in Central Africa is burning?

Hello @falconxtr ,

Due to the resolution at that level it looks like all of Central Africa is on fire. If you zoom in you can see that the whole land is not on fire but there are a lot of detected hot spots. See here: https://firms.modaps.eosdis.nasa.gov/map/#d:24hrs;@23.7,-8.6,6.8z

Also see our FAQ question, Are all active fire hotspots vegetation fires?, https://www.earthdata.nasa.gov/data/tools/firms/faq#heading-accordion-124439-6
